About the International Rescue Committee (IRC)

Founded in 1933 at the request of Albert Einstein, the IRC is a leading humanitarian NGO operating in 40+ crisis-affected countries and 29 U.S. cities. The organization delivers emergency relief, health care, education, and economic empowerment to millions displaced by conflict and disaster.

Airbel Impact Lab: Innovating for Scale

The Airbel Impact Lab is IRC’s research and innovation arm, combining behavioral science, human-centered design, and rigorous data analysis to develop cost-effective, scalable solutions in:

  • Health (Nutrition, SRH, Communicable Diseases)
  • Economic Wellbeing
  • Education & Protection
  • Climate Resilience

Role Overview

The Data Science Research Lead will modernize IRC’s research data infrastructure, ensuring high-quality, ethical, and efficient data practices. Key focus areas include:

  • Standardizing data systems for global research projects.
  • Pioneering AI/ML, geospatial, and alternative data (e.g., satellite, mobile data) applications.
  • Mentoring teams in advanced analytics and low-resource tech solutions.

Location: Hybrid (U.S.-based)
Travel: Up to 10% to conflict zones.


Tasks & Responsibilities

1. Upgrade IRC’s Research Data Systems

  • Develop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for data capture, management, and analysis.
  • Create shared resources (e.g., electronic survey templates, dashboards, code repositories).
  • Train researchers and field staff on best practices (STATA/R, CommCare, Power BI).
  • Audit and optimize legacy datasets for reuse in new studies.

2. Deploy Cutting-Edge Data Science Methods

  • Identify frontier technologies (e.g., AI-driven data synthesis, adaptive RCTs, chatbot analytics).
  • Pilot innovative tools (e.g., satellite imagery, mobile data) in low-resource settings.
  • Build vendor partnerships for underutilized tech (e.g., AI-powered survey platforms).

3. Foster a Data-Driven Research Culture

  • Establish a community of practice for advanced analytics.
  • Mentor teams on predictive modeling, geospatial analysis, and real-time monitoring.
  • Collaborate with MEAL (Monitoring, Evaluation, Accountability & Learning) teams to align research with program impact.
